Job Description:

We are looking for an experienced Tool and Die Maker to join our 2nd shift team. The Tool and Die Maker is responsible for building jigs

fixtures

and dies and oversees the machining of all parts through the machining process leading up to assembly and try out of the tool. The Tool and Die Maker is capable of overseeing projects at an advanced level. This position considered a leader in the plant and is responsible for guiding entry and intermediate level Tool and Die Makers. Only the very best Machinists are classified in this role. Will be actively involved in continuous improvement teams within the area to promote safety

quality

throughout and the addition of any new equipment. The ideal candidate is an organized

analytical

problem-solver with the ability to prioritize and delegate tasks to ensure that daily operations are running effectively and efficiently.

Responsibilities


  • Reads advanced assembly drawings and determines priorities.
  • Receives all materials and determines the best process to complete the work.
  • Grinds all parts to specification for fit up.
  • Assembles all components.
  • Aligns sections for clearances.
  • Dowels all components in place.
  • Tries out tool onsite or at user's facility.
  • Involved with continuous improvement efforts.
  • Trains and coordinates lower-level tool and die.
  • Works with Engineers and Operations Manager to determine machining.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Worthington Steel (NYSE:WS) is a metals processor that partners with customers to deliver highly technical and customized solutions. Worthington Steel's expertise in carbon flat-roll steel processing

electrical steel laminations and tailor welded solutions are driving steel toward a more sustainable future.

As one of the most trusted metals processors in North America

Worthington Steel and its 4,600 employees harness the power of steel to advance our customers' visions through value-added processing capabilities including galvanizing

pickling

configured blanking

specialty cold reduction

lightweighting and electrical lamination. Headquartered in Columbus

Ohio

Worthington operates 32 facilities in seven states and six countries. Following a people-first Philosophy

commitment to sustainability and proven business system

Worthington Steel's purpose is to generate positive returns by providing trusted and innovative solutions for customers

creating opportunities for employees

and strengthening its communities.
